Professional OBD-II Scanning
Detect faults with greater speed with advanced OBD-II scanning that reads live data, freeze frames, pending codes, and manufacturer-specific (Mode 6) parameters. You get a comprehensive picture of sensor behavior when loaded, at idle, and during transient events, so we can confirm or rule out issues without guesswork. Our tools log misfire counters, fuel trims, oxygen sensor switching, EVAP test results, and catalyst efficiency with time-stamped accuracy.
We embed real time telematics to correlate road conditions, driver inputs, and environmental factors with fault occurrences. With custom OBD‑II apps, we customize data PIDs, graph trends, and execute bi-directional controls to command actuators, run system tests, and verify repairs. You leave with confirmed results, reduced downtime, and a documented path from code retrieval to confirmed resolution.
Exact Fault Detection
Zero in on the root cause with a structured diagnostic workflow that connects symptoms to verifiable test results. We start by confirming your concern, cataloging codes, freeze-frame data, and operating conditions. Then we identify variables: check power, ground, and signal integrity, conduct wiring diagnostics with individual pin checks, and verify component operation under load. We compare live data against specifications and conduct focused tests to rule out false positives.
If a sensor signals a malfunction, we don't guess—we verify with multimeter, oscilloscope, and reliable references. Sensor calibration follows factory guidelines to provide accurate readings and stable control strategies. We road-test to recreate the scenario, monitor data streams, and confirm repeatability. You obtain clear findings, not assumptions, so repairs resolve the exact failure and restore reliable performance.

Engine, Transmission, and Drivetrain Specialization
Although symptom patterns may intersect, we diagnose engine, transmission, and drivetrain problems with data-driven diagnostics prior to any repair work. We scan live PIDs, perform compression and leak-down tests, verify fuel trims, and evaluate ignition patterns to solve rough idle, cold starts, or oil dilution from misfires and short trips. You get detailed results, repair options, and expected outcomes.
Regarding transmissions, we evaluate line pressure, shift timing, solenoid duty cycles, and fluid condition to prevent slip, flare, or harsh engagements. We reflash TCM/PCM when strategy updates address drivability concerns.
Drivetrain assessments cover CV joints, U-joints, differential lash, and wheel bearing noise analysis. We check angles and balance to remove vibration under load. You sign off on every step, and we document findings so you comprehend root cause, repair method, and warranty terms.

Brake System Inspections and Repairs
Brake safely—our ASE-certified technicians conduct thorough brake inspections and precise repairs to ensure your stopping power safe and reliable. We check pad thickness, caliper performance, rotor runout, and hose integrity, then log results so you know which issues are urgent and which can be addressed later. If rotors are within specifications, we perform rotor resurfacing to return a flat, consistent braking surface; otherwise, we recommend replacement.
We test brake fluid for moisture and boiling point, flush systems to clear air, and verify ABS functionality. You receive a clear noise diagnosis for pulsation, squeals, or grinding, targeting root causes instead of guessing. We also adjust and service your parking brake for secure holds and proper release. Steering, Alignment, and Safety
Properly aligned steering maintains your vehicle tracking straight, protects tires, and protects critical components. At Master Auto Care, we evaluate toe, camber, and caster to factory specs, then restore them with precision equipment. If you experience pull, off-center wheel, or irregular tire wear, a complete wheel alignment returns geometry and decreases braking distances by keeping the contact patch ideal.
We additionally examine steering racks, tie-rod ends, control arms, and bushings for wear that can affect alignment. Our safety checks confirm torque on fasteners, steering angle sensor calibration, and tire pressures to deliver consistent response under load. We perform road tests to ensure proper steering feel and stability at speed. You leave with written readings, clear recommendations, and a steering system tuned for optimal safety and longevity.
Advanced Electrical Systems Troubleshooting
Even though today's vehicles rely on progressively complex electronics, you still need precise, methodical diagnostics when warning lights appear, accessories fail, or a no-start situation arises. We start with a validated concern, check battery health and voltage drop, then isolate faults using circuit mapping to trace power and ground paths. We examine fuses, relays, and modules under load, not just visually.
Next, we hook up a scan tool to retrieve live data and stored codes, then validate with oscilloscope waveform analysis. This allows us see sensor signals, injector control, and CAN bus activity in real time, distinguishing intermittent faults from hard failures. We repair corroded connectors, pin-fit issues, and damaged harnesses, then complete a final functional test drive. You leave with restored reliability and confidence.
